CourseDetails
- Introduction to Design of Experiments (DOE): Understanding the basics of DOE, its importance, and applications in data visualization.
- Experimental Design Techniques: Learning various experimental design techniques such as full factorial, fractional factorial, and response surface methodology.
- Data Analysis and Visualization Tools: Exploring popular data analysis and visualization tools like R, Python, and Tableau.
- Planning and Conducting Experiments: Understanding the process of planning and conducting experiments, including defining objectives, identifying variables, and selecting experimental design.
- Data Collection and Management: Learning best practices for data collection, cleaning, and management to ensure accurate and reliable results.
- Statistical Analysis and Modeling: Understanding statistical analysis and modeling techniques for DOE, including ANOVA, regression analysis, and hypothesis testing.
- Interpreting and Presenting Results: Learning how to interpret and present DOE results using data visualization techniques and tools.
- Optimization and Validation: Understanding how to optimize and validate experimental designs to ensure robust and reliable results.
- Real-World Applications: Exploring real-world applications of DOE for data visualization in various industries such as manufacturing, healthcare, and finance.
- Ethics and Compliance: Understanding ethical considerations and compliance requirements in DOE for data visualization.
